In ecology, sustainability is how biological systems remain diverse and productive. Long-lived and healthy wetlands and forests are examples of sustainable biological systems. In more general terms, sustainability is the endurance of systems and processes.

Respecting environments ensures that communities have adequate resources to meet their needs and many of their wants. Tropical forests provide ingredients for important medicines, for instance, and sustainable use of such resources ensures they’ll continue to exist for future generations. Natural resources provide income for communities as well, both directly and indirectly. Whether communities rely on timber exports, ecotourism or imported raw materials used to produce an end product, natural resources provide livelihoods for communities.
